automatic transmission (plural automatic transmissions)
- (automotive) A vehicle transmission which shifts gears automatically in response to vehicle speed and/or load, and does not require any driver input to manually change gears under normal driving conditions; an automatic gearbox.
- Antonyms: manual transmission, standard transmission, stickshift
